CI Troubleshooting — Lendora Exchange Module. The nightly build flagged intermittent failures in the currency conversion suite. Root cause: the converter rounds at each intermediate hop instead of once at the final step, so GBP→USD→JPY paths drift by up to 0.02 per thousand units. The fix in the Farrow branch defers rounding until display formatting, and we added property-based tests seeded across 40 currency pairs. Please hold the release train until the suite passes twice consecutively. The verified build token appears on the line below.

session token of yajof-bagef = htk4_937d

Filing this ahead of the Thursday release: the circuit breaker wrapping the upstream Ledgerline API began tripping permanently at 03:10 because the health-probe credentials for our internal StatusWeave service expired. Breaker state cannot recover until the probe authenticates again. A replacement key has been issued and validated in staging. Please include the config update in the release; the new StatusWeave key follows below.

gateway credential: kto3_qfe

## Provenance notes for the Kilncart migration

Welcome aboard! Short version: we're moving Kilncart's build from the old scripts to the hermetic Forgepin system, so every artifact is reproducible byte-for-byte. No more "works on my machine" toolchains — everything's pinned, sandboxed, and network-free at build time. When filing provenance questions, always cite the exact build you're looking at. The current reference build is recorded just below.

trace token, fafog-kageg: htk4_98e6

- [ ] **Step 7: Breaker override escrow.** After sealing the signing keys for the Tallgrove upstream API circuit breaker, confirm the support team can force the breaker open during a full outage. The override bundle lives in the sealed escrow drawer and is useless without its unlock phrase. Two ceremony witnesses must initial this step before proceeding. The escrow bundle is decrypted with the recovery passphrase that follows.

vault phrase of kahip-kahop = holath-quenmir